Output 16531b9c6c7c39522bf5f1e42b7d8d10758ac71101b1256fc7e1bd0b78f9467a:0

value
1637935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c5017b5b80d2b87301091cb5a7bf6560c04d44 OP_EQUAL
address
3JSharJcEEU6d9BhQVvrYowTc4mwavzx9C
transaction
16531b9c6c7c39522bf5f1e42b7d8d10758ac71101b1256fc7e1bd0b78f9467a
spent
true